Abstract

The utility model relates to the technical field of distribution boxes and discloses an oil field rainproof low-voltage distribution box which comprises a base, wherein a concave plate is fixedly installed at the inner top of the base, a bottom plate is placed at the bottom in the concave plate, hollow cavities are formed in four corners in the bottom plate, clamping rods penetrate through the left side and the right side of the bottom plate, clamping grooves are formed in the bottoms of the left inner wall and the right inner wall of the concave plate, the clamping rods are clamped in the clamping grooves on the same side, guide blocks are fixedly installed at the inner ends of the clamping rods, and springs are sleeved on the outer sides, close to the guide blocks, of the clamping rods. According to the utility model, through the arrangement of the inclined plane, the movable block and the spring, in the process of disassembling and assembling the distribution box, the clamping rod can be automatically moved along with the placement of the distribution box and the lifting of the distribution box, the distribution box is disassembled and assembled without assistance of other people, the labor input cost is reduced, and the distribution box is suitable for wide popularization and use.

Technical Field
The utility model relates to the technical field of distribution boxes, in particular to a rain-proof low-voltage distribution box for an oil field.
Background
The distribution box is a mass parameter on data, generally forms a low-voltage distribution box by assembling switching equipment, measuring instruments, protective electrical appliances and auxiliary equipment in a closed or semi-closed metal cabinet or on a screen according to electrical wiring. In normal operation, the circuit can be switched on or off by means of a manual or automatic switch. The distribution box has the characteristics of small volume, simple and convenient installation, special technical performance, fixed position, unique configuration function, no field limitation, more common application, stable and reliable operation, high space utilization rate, less occupied area and environmental protection effect. The intelligent power distribution circuit can reasonably distribute electric energy, is convenient for the opening and closing operation of the circuit, has higher safety protection level, and can visually display the conduction state of the circuit.

In a preferred embodiment of the present invention, a reinforcing rib is fixedly installed at a connection portion between the strut and the ceiling.
As a preferred embodiment of the present invention, a through hole is formed in the top of the front wall of the distribution box, and a louver is fixedly installed at the through hole.
As a preferred embodiment of the utility model, a plurality of groups of uniformly arrayed fixing cones are fixedly arranged on the lower surface of the base.
In a preferred embodiment of the utility model, a return plate is fixedly mounted at the bottom of the outer wall of the distribution box, and the return plate is attached to the inner wall of the concave plate.
Compared with the prior art, the utility model has the following beneficial effects:
1. according to the rainproof low-voltage distribution box for the oil field, the inclined plane, the movable block and the spring are arranged, so that the clamping rod can be automatically moved along with the placement of the distribution box and the lifting of the distribution box in the distribution box dismounting process, the distribution box dismounting process does not need assistance of other people, and the labor input cost is reduced.

In this embodiment (as shown in fig. 1), a reinforcing rib is fixedly installed at a joint of the strut 3 and the ceiling 4, and the connection rigidity of the corner can be improved by the reinforcing rib, so that the tearing and toppling condition is prevented.
In this embodiment (as shown in fig. 1), the opening has been seted up at 5 antetheca tops of block terminal, and opening department fixed mounting has the shutter for the ventilation and heat dissipation of block terminal 5.
In this embodiment (as shown in fig. 1), a plurality of groups of fixing cones 2 uniformly arrayed are fixedly mounted on the lower surface of the base 1, and can be inserted into soil through the fixing cones 2, so as to ensure the stability of positioning.
In this embodiment (as shown in fig. 1), the bottom of the outer wall of the distribution box 5 is fixedly provided with a return plate 6, the return plate 6 is attached to the inner wall of the concave plate 7, and the return plate 6 is matched with the concave plate 7 to limit the placing position of the distribution box 5, so as to ensure smooth proceeding of subsequent clamping.
